Conversation on technology forecasting and gradualism

This post is a transcript of a multi-day discussion between Paul Christiano, Richard Ngo, Eliezer Yudkowsky, Rob Bensinger, Holden Karnofsky, Rohin Shah, Carl Shulman, Nate Soares, and Jaan Tallinn, following up on the Yudkowsky/Christiano debate in 1, 2, 3, and 4.

This was originally posted on 9th Dec 2021.
